The SDQ is a brief screening instrument that can be used with children and adolescents aged 3-16 years. Available in over 60 languages, the SDQ is a validated screening instrument widely used in Europe, Asia, Australia and the United States (Warnick, Braken & Kasl, 2008). CPP Cohort 4. The Strengths and Difficulties Questionnaire (SDQ)* is a brief screening questionnaire used to assess caregiver perceptions of positive and negative psychological attributes of children. Two versions were used: SDQ: 2-4 years and SDQ: 4-10 years; cutoff scores vary by version. The Strengths and Difficulties Questionnaire (SDQ) is a brief, 25-item, measure of behavioural and emotional difficulties that can be used to assess mental health problems in children and young people aged 4-17 years [1, 2].The SDQ can capture the perspective of the child/young person (self-report), or their parents and teachers perspective of the child's symptoms.Strengths and Difficulties Questionnaire. Strengths and Difficulties Questionnaire is a 25-item brief behavioral screening tool that measures behaviors, emotions and relationships of children (Goodman, 1997). In this study, the SDQ version for children aged 4–10 years completed by the parent or primary caregiver was evaluated.The Strengths and Difficulties Questionnaire (SDQ) for 2–4 year olds is a 25-item measure designed to assess behaviours, emotions and relationships over the last six months in ... out the Total Difficulties score. The overall (five-subscale) SDQ score ranges from 0 to 50, with a higher score indicating abnormal behaviours. SDQscore.org is the original, continuously improved, website for transcribing and scoring SDQ ...The Strengths and Difficulties Questionnaire (SDQ) is a brief behavioural screening questionnaire about 2-17 year olds. It exists in several versions to meet the needs of researchers, clinicians and educationalists. Each version includes between one and three of the following components: A) 25 items on psychological attributes.
